Abstract: The Integrative Design Process (IDP) is a powerful collaborative framework that aligns with an institution's culture to cost-effectively achieve any project's desired outcomes. After adopting IDP incrementally since 2003, Princeton University has created a full program, including a roadmap and in-depth training. A well-designed IDP supports participation and buy-in from users and effective collaboration in project teams-that means fewer changes during the construction documents phase and construction, smoother turnover, and better performance. Abstract: In order to achieve their ambitious goal of decarbonization by 2035, Swarthmore College carried out the design and planned implementation of new campus energy systems. We'll discuss Swarthmore's experience in the actual implementation of decarbonization strategies and share the latest information on cost, carbon reduction, and phasing considerations. Come learn how to evaluate central plant strategies, geoexchange wellfields, and renewable power sources and apply these valuable strategies to create a sustainable decarbonized environment for your campus community.
